Second Nature

Platform Overview

Second Nature is an AI sales training platform delivering conversation practice through voice-based AI characters with customizable personalities. 

Built-in learning management system combines scenario practice with certification workflows. One-hour deployment timeline addresses urgent training needs, while multilingual support spans 20+ languages.

Second Nature maintains pre-built scenario structures similar to TrainHQ while adding enterprise scalability through integrated LMS capabilities, faster deployment timelines, and voice-based AI that creates more realistic practice pressure than text-based alternatives.

Core Features

  • Customizable AI personas with personality traits and assigned emotional states

  • Real-time performance feedback with immediate scoring

  • Multilingual support across 20+ languages

  • Built-in learning management system

  • One-hour deployment from onboarding to first practice

  • Golden standard recordings from top performers

  • Automated feedback and consistent scoring

Pros

  • Proven enterprise track record with Fortune 100 customers

  • Integrated LMS eliminates the need for separate learning platforms

  • Rapid one-hour deployment addresses urgent training timelines

  • 20+ language support enables global rollout

Cons

  • No screen-sharing capability for demo or presentation practice

  • Sales-focused exclusively without extending to customer success or management

  • Custom enterprise pricing lacks transparent published rates

  • Requires company materials for scenario creation rather than instant generation

  • Limited to voice and avatar-based practice without visual feedback

Hyperbound

Platform Overview

Hyperbound is an AI roleplay platform specializing in SDR cold calling, powered by deep CRM integrations that pull customer profile data. Bot builder technology converts ICP descriptions into 

AI buyer personas within two minutes. Gamified learning paths include competitions and leaderboards tracking team performance, with support spanning 25+ languages for international teams.

Hyperbound shifts from TrainHQ's pre-built, generic scenarios to a CRM-integrated, data-driven prospecting practice that mirrors actual customer profiles, though the scope remains limited to outbound calling rather than full sales-cycle conversations.

Core Features

  • Bot builder converting ICP descriptions into AI prospects

  • Deep CRM integrations with Salesforce and HubSpot

  • Gamified learning paths with competitions and leaderboards

  • 25+ language support for international teams

  • LMS integration with WorkRamp and similar platforms

  • Meeting recorder integrations (Gong, Chorus, Fireflies)

  • Real-time feedback with consistent scoring

Pros

  • CRM-integrated scenarios grounded in actual customer data

  • Gamification drives engagement through competitions and leaderboards

  • SDR specialization optimized for cold calling excellence

  • 25+ languages support international teams

Cons

  • Cold calling specialization limits broader applications

  • No screen-sharing for demo or presentation practice

  • CRM dependency for maximum value (Salesforce/HubSpot required)

  • Best for SDR/BDR teams only, rather than the full sales cycle

  • Custom pricing only, without transparent published rates

Yoodli

Platform Overview

Yoodli is an AI-driven communication coaching platform focused on delivery analytics rather than sales methodology. The platform tracks pacing, filler words, and clarity and provides real-time nudges during actual calls that participants see privately. 

Post-call analytics measure communication improvements over time, while multi-persona mode enables practice with up to three simultaneous AI characters.

Yoodli shifts from TrainHQ's sales scenario focus to communication-delivery coaching, emphasizing how reps speak rather than what they say, strategically during customer conversations.

Core Features

  • Real-time speech feedback during live calls with private on-screen nudges

  • Post-call analytics measuring pacing, filler words, pauses, eye contact, tone

  • AI roleplay simulations for sales, interviews, and public speaking

  • Multi-persona mode with up to three simultaneous AI characters

  • Salesforce and Gong integrations

  • Progress tracking dashboard with improvement benchmarks

Pros

  • Generous free tier (five sessions) for platform evaluation

  • Real-time coaching during actual calls

  • Individual accessibility without enterprise commitment

  • Excellent for delivery coaching (pacing, filler words, confidence)

Cons

  • No screen-sharing capability for demo practice

  • Delivery-focused rather than strategic conversation content

  • Not sales-methodology-specific without customization

  • Free plan includes data in AI training (privacy concern)

  • Limited enterprise features compared to dedicated platforms

  • Focuses on how you speak rather than what you say strategically

Mindtickle

Platform Overview

Mindtickle is a comprehensive sales-readiness platform that integrates AI-powered role-plays with sales enablement, coaching, conversation intelligence, and digital sales rooms. AI-powered roleplays via Copilot assistant provide real-time support during deals. 

Conversation intelligence analyzes sales calls automatically, while digital sales rooms enable buyer collaboration throughout deal cycles.

Mindtickle expands beyond TrainHQ's focused role-play approach to a sales-readiness infrastructure, trading deployment simplicity and practice specialization for platform breadth, consolidating multiple enablement functions.

Core Features

  • AI-powered roleplays via Copilot assistant with real-time support

  • Script scenarios and global pitch competitions

  • AI feedback grading thousands of submissions rapidly

  • Integrated sales enablement, coaching, and performance management

  • Conversation intelligence with automatic call analysis

  • Digital sales rooms for buyer engagement

  • Comprehensive analytics correlating training to revenue

Pros

  • A single integrated platform eliminates vendor fragmentation

  • Sales performance improvement across the full lifecycle

  • Strong analytics and reporting capabilities

  • Proven enterprise scale with a large customer base

Cons

  • Complex platform with a steeper learning curve

  • High cost with enterprise-only pricing (estimated $30-50 per user monthly)

  • It can feel overwhelming for smaller teams

  • Implementation takes time rather than enabling fast deployment

  • Roleplay represents a newer feature versus core platform capabilities

  • No screen-sharing for demo practice

Quantified

Platform Overview

Quantified delivers photorealistic AI avatar simulations measuring over 1,000 verbal and non-verbal behaviors during practice sessions. The platform serves high-stakes sales environments across life sciences, financial services, and insurance, where regulatory compliance is critical.

ComplianceGuard AI automatically enforces regulatory standards, while the SOC 2 Type 2 architecture protects sensitive data. Full audit trails document certification processes for compliance reporting.

Quantified shifts from TrainHQ's general sales training to compliance-focused simulations purpose-built for regulated industries where conversation missteps create legal liability.

Core Features

  • Photorealistic AI avatars that create ultra-realistic visual simulations

  • Behavioral analytics measuring 1,000+ verbal and non-verbal behaviors

  • ComplianceGuard AI enforcing regulatory standards automatically

  • SOC 2 Type 2 compliant architecture with private AI models

  • Industry-leading latency and responsiveness for realism

  • Emotionally intelligent AI personas adapting in real-time

  • Full audit trail for certification and compliance documentation

Pros

  • Purpose-built for regulated industries (pharma, finance, insurance)

  • SOC 2 Type 2 certification meets stringent security standards

  • Photorealistic avatars create immersive practice presence

  • Behavioral analytics measuring 1,000+ behaviors

  • Full audit trails for compliance documentation

Cons

  • No screen-sharing for demo or presentation practice

  • Custom enterprise pricing without transparency

  • Enterprise-only focus excludes individual and SMB plans

  • Longer setup time requires LMS and CRM integration

  • Regulated industry specialization may represent overkill for simpler sales

  • Sales-only positioning excludes customer success and management

FullyRamped

Platform Overview

FullyRamped is an AI-powered sales training platform focused on accelerating SDR and BDR onboarding through unlimited custom roleplay practice. Practice Prospects feature transforms real call recordings from Gong into AI roleplays, grounding training in actual customer conversations. Automated AI certifications verify readiness before reps engage prospects, while manager dashboards track team progress across practice activities.

FullyRamped shifts from TrainHQ's general sales practice to specialized SDR and BDR onboarding acceleration, emphasizing unlimited practice volume and real-call integration.

Core Features

  • AI scenario builder with multi-language support

  • Unlimited custom roleplay creation

  • Practice Prospects turning Gong recordings into AI scenarios

  • Automated AI certification with grading

  • Real-call analysis and coaching

  • Manager dashboards with team analytics

  • Gong, Clari, Salesloft integrations

Pros

  • Real-call integration turns Gong recordings into practice roleplay scenarios

  • SDR and BDR specialization optimized for phone prospecting

  • Hyperrealistic AI conversations

  • Automated certification reduces manager burden

  • Unlimited custom AI roleplays

Cons

  • No screen-sharing for demo practice

  • Five-seat minimum requirement excludes smaller teams

  • Integration dependency for best value (requires Gong, Clari, or Salesloft)

  • Custom pricing only without transparency

  • SDR-focused limits have proven effectiveness for the full sales cycle
